aboutsummaryrefslogtreecommitdiffstats
path: root/modules/services/adminService
diff options
context:
space:
mode:
authorAngelo Naselli <anaselli@linux.it>2014-01-06 19:59:29 +0100
committerAngelo Naselli <anaselli@linux.it>2014-01-06 19:59:29 +0100
commite4abf51415f1871a29f81b2c033fda0cb64a276a (patch)
treeddca8e169a4c2724bf4257c0955ec035bd35d479 /modules/services/adminService
parent00950d42d1eaed19349aecfbc3ff2fe34ee7c905 (diff)
downloadmanatools-e4abf51415f1871a29f81b2c033fda0cb64a276a.tar
manatools-e4abf51415f1871a29f81b2c033fda0cb64a276a.tar.gz
manatools-e4abf51415f1871a29f81b2c033fda0cb64a276a.tar.bz2
manatools-e4abf51415f1871a29f81b2c033fda0cb64a276a.tar.xz
manatools-e4abf51415f1871a29f81b2c033fda0cb64a276a.zip
- Admin service is now splitted (gui and utility)
- Admin service extends Module - fixed load modules from categories.conf.d
Diffstat (limited to 'modules/services/adminService')
-rwxr-xr-xmodules/services/adminService23
1 files changed, 23 insertions, 0 deletions
diff --git a/modules/services/adminService b/modules/services/adminService
new file mode 100755
index 00000000..d4f8fe39
--- /dev/null
+++ b/modules/services/adminService
@@ -0,0 +1,23 @@
+#!/usr/bin/perl
+
+use strict;
+use lib qw(/usr/lib/libDrakX);
+
+use standalone; #- warning, standalone must be loaded very first, for 'explanations'
+
+use common;
+use AdminPanel::Shared;
+use AdminPanel::Services::AdminService;
+use log;
+
+use yui;
+
+my $wm_icon = "/usr/share/mcc/themes/default/service-mdk.png";
+
+yui::YUI::app()->setApplicationTitle(N("Services and daemons"));
+yui::YUI::app()->setApplicationIcon($wm_icon);
+
+my $serviceMan = AdminPanel::Services::AdminService->new();
+$serviceMan->start();
+
+1;